Powerful earthquake hits east New Zealand

By Recep Sakar

MELBOURNE, Australia (AA) – A powerful earthquake has struck eastern New Zealand.

The United States Geological Survey reported that the magnitude 7.4 temblor struck around 93 kilometers (57.8 miles) northeast of Christchurch, the largest city in the country’s South Island, shortly after midnight Sunday.

It occurred at a shallow depth of 10 km.

According to the Pacific Tsunami Warning Center, there is no tsunami threat.

There were no immediate reports of causalities or damage.

New Zealand sits on the Ring of Fire, an area in the Pacific Ocean where a large number of earthquakes and volcanic eruptions occur.
